Admission Changes by Gender

The men to women applicants ratio is 41 to 58 for the academic year 2023-2024. There are slightly more female applicants than male applicants at UConn School of Medicine. There are slightly more female matriculants than male matriculants at UConn School of Medicine.

Enrollment Changes from 2022 to 2024

A total of 501 students enrolled in UConn School of Medicine with 219 men and 282 women students. The men to women student ratio is 44 to 56 at UConn School of Medicine.
